Output 65c199486181e4f22c954ad49cd8db4731f301369d19b825c772ae9ef0e1675e:1

value
8633323
script pubkey
OP_0 OP_PUSHBYTES_20 d28ae37a8e9e76944ff97800358f0e634ef8f593
address
bc1q629wx75wnemfgnle0qqrtrcwvd803avn9uv4mq
transaction
65c199486181e4f22c954ad49cd8db4731f301369d19b825c772ae9ef0e1675e
spent
true